Come riempire una zona compresa tra una curva limite superiore e inferiore su un grafico a dispersione

StackOverflow https://stackoverflow.com/questions/2244348

  •  19-09-2019
  •  | 
  •  

Domanda

Ho una tabella che ha una sola linea che vorrei mettere un cono di confine su.

posso tracciare le due linee per i valori limite superiore e inferiore - ma mi piacerebbe per ombreggiare l'area tra le due linee di confine

.

Come posso fare questo? / Posso fare questo?

È stato utile?

Soluzione

Un modo che è stato suggerito per questo nel Nucleo quadro Plot era per creare due grafici a dispersione all'interno di un singolo grafico, hanno la più alta usare un riempimento di colore, poi quello inferiore usare un riempimento dello stesso colore dello sfondo del grafico. Se ordinate le trame in modo che quello inferiore rende dopo quello superiore, sarà efficacemente mascherare la parte inferiore dove si intersecano e lasciare solo l'area tra i due colori. Il href="http://www.alt12.com/products" rel="nofollow noreferrer"> applicazione fa con il loro grafico Plot core (vedi il terzo screenshot sulla loro pagina del prodotto) .

Sarebbe più elegante per noi sostenere in modo nativo, così potremmo voler aggiungere questa funzionalità per il quadro.

Altri suggerimenti

Credo che si sta cercando di implementare qualcosa di simile (vedi file allegato).

Come ho risolto questo problema:
1. Avete bisogno di coordinate per le linee superiore e inferiore Pagina 2. valori Ordina cima dai ascendente Pagina 3. valori inferiori sorta nel discendente Pagina 4. Combinare i valori di fondo superiore ordinato e un array
5. Applicare il colore di riempimento per tracciare

Per dire lunga storia breve, è necessario percorso trama chiuso. entrare descrizione dell'immagine qui

scroll top